Manor council approves three downtown Boyce Street development agreements and related Chapter 380 grant terms

Manor City Council · October 16, 2024

Summary

Council approved three development agreements and matching Chapter 380 grant agreements for the Boyce PJT project (101, 104/108 and 107 W. Boyce Street), clearing the way for roughly $3.5M–$4.5M in private capital per tract, with downtown parking, drainage and tree removal left for later permitting and P&Z review.

The Manor City Council voted to approve three separate development agreements and corresponding Chapter 380 economic incentive agreements for a multi-tract downtown redevelopment collectively called “The Boyce.” The approved packages cover 101 West Boyce, 104/108 West Boyce and 107 West Boyce Street and allow staff and developers to finalize legal formatting corrections before execution.
